Pre-Project Checklist for Asphalt Work
Before any crew starts, a strong asphalt paving plan prevents rework and protects long-term performance. Confirm site access for equipment and deliveries, review property boundaries, and verify drainage paths so water won’t pool under or around the new surface. Take photos of existing pavement conditions, note cracks, ruts, or failed patches, and document asphalt paving Broward County any utility concerns. Request a written scope that covers demo or milling, base preparation, paving thickness, edging, and cleanup. If you’re planning driveway paving, parking lot surfacing, or road improvements, ensure the design matches the intended vehicle loads and traffic patterns for your property.
Site Preparation Requirements to Verify
Quality asphalt starts beneath the top layer. Ask the contractor to confirm that the existing base is evaluated and stabilized before paving. The checklist should include proper grading, removal of unsuitable material, and installation of a compacted aggregate base sized for the surface use. Verify that subgrade compaction is measured and that geotextile is driveway paving Palm Beach County used when conditions call for separation or stabilization. Check that forms and edges are set for clean lines, and confirm that drainage features are protected. For driveway paving, also verify that transitions at garage aprons and walkways are planned to reduce cracking and surface separation.
>Build Quality Checks During Installation
During installation, you can monitor key steps that determine durability. Confirm that tack coat is applied where required for adhesion, that asphalt mix is delivered and placed at proper temperatures, and that lifts are rolled consistently for density. Ensure rolling includes coverage of edges and joints, and that workmanship avoids gaps, segregation, or uneven texture. Asphalt should be smooth, level, and properly sloped for water runoff. If the project includes driveway paving, also check that final grade allows safe vehicle movement without ponding. Ask how joints are treated and what curing and protection steps are recommended before normal use.
